University or Organization: Word of Mouth
Job Location: Tokyo, Japan
Job Rank: Linguistic Project Manager
Specialty Areas: Computational Linguistics; General Linguistics; Phonetics; Asian Languages; Natural Language Processing
Required Language(s): Japanese (jpn)
Description:
The Linguistic Project Manager will oversee and manage speech projects for Tokyo, Japan. The candidate will manage a team of Data Evaluators and work on analyzing textnorm performance, overseeing lexicon/phoneset, basic text decoding, and QA studio recordings. This includes: - Assisting/mentoring Data Evaluators on the following tasks: (i) Semiotic classification/disambiguation work (ii) Phonetic transcription (to create new lexicon entries) using our phoneset and our standards (iii) Proofreading script for voice talent, and editing for readability - Create verbalization rules, such as expanding URLs, email addresses, numbers - Provide expertise on pronunciations - Annotate pronunciation for new lexicon entries after familiarizing themselves with our phoneme set and transcription standards - Perform basic text normalization task on a huge amount of text data - Work with QA tools according to the guidelines Job Requirements: - Native-level speaker of Japanese (Hiragana) - must have attended elementary school in a region where specific dialect is spoken - Linguistic (phonetics) background helpful - Keen ear for phonetic nuances - Previous experience in managing external resources - Ability to quickly grasp technical concepts - Proficiency with key project management and tracking tools - Excellent oral and written communicator - Proficiency with HTML, Python, and experience building internal tools a plus - Experience working with Voice Talents and recording studios - Studies in Linguistics, Computational Linguistics preferred The candidate will work on-site at the Tokyo Google office. Project duration: 1 year (with potential for extension); available to start full time in January, 2012.
